Output 61876327b90e47570ca054e37f9310eaf0ec6fc94a64dcdb6a66dcd86a7dc8be:0

value
4300000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cc18adc54177e95d33027e0aa789f6fd34b922d4 OP_EQUALVERIFY OP_CHECKSIG
address
1KcAQr4XGR5RGVndk1LhBeueYaRuMRtsnz
transaction
61876327b90e47570ca054e37f9310eaf0ec6fc94a64dcdb6a66dcd86a7dc8be
confirmations
134419
spent
true